Immanuel Christian had to start their season on the road on Saturday, and it wasn't the start they were hoping for. They took a blow against the Elida Tigers, falling 64-24.
Benjamin Frecka threw for 66 yards and two TDs. Jeremiah Alarcon was his top target, picking up 47 receiving yards and a pair of touchdowns. On the ground, Alam Canales rushed for 62 yards.
Cason Norman had a dynamite game For Elida., rushing for 260 yards and six scores on only 15 carries. Norman's rushing production has been exceptional as that marked his sixth straight game with at least 220 rushing yards dating back to last season. Chase Aguiri was in the mix too, providing Elida with two touchdowns.
Elida pushed their record up to 2-0 with the win, which was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season.
Coming up, Immanuel Christian will challenge Sierra Blanca at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Elida, they are headed away from home for the first time to face off against New Mexico School for the Deaf at 3:00 p.m. on Thursday. This will be the Tigers' first chance to prove their worth in the conference.
